Teaching Activities

Teaching of surgery to undergraduates in Years 3,4,5 of the Direct Entry Medical Programme, and Years 2, 3, 4 of the Graduate Entry Medical Programme I co-ordinate module CP5100 - Surgery for Final Med Particular interest in bedside and clinical teaching in small groups I also teach Advanced Trauma Life Support to post-graduate trainees
